  • EXPENSE PROVISION Until this agreement shall be amended or terminated pursuant to Section 2 or Section 5 hereof, the Manager agrees, with respect to Class Z6, to pay or provide for the payment of any fee or expense allocated at the class level and attributable to Class Z6 and waive a portion of the management fee payable by such class, such that the ordinary operating expenses incurred by Class Z6 in any fiscal year (excluding (i) taxes; (ii) the fees and expenses of all Trustees of the Trust who are not “interested persons” of the Trust or of the Adviser; (iii) interest expenses with respect to borrowings by the Fund; (iv) Rule 12b-1 fees, if any; (v) expenses of printing and mailing proxy materials to shareholders of the Fund; (vi) all other expenses incidental to holding meetings of the Fund’s shareholders, including proxy solicitations therefor; and (vii) such non-recurring and/or extraordinary expenses as may arise, including actions, suits or proceedings to which the Fund is or is threatened to be a party and the legal obligation that the Fund may have to indemnify the Trust’s Trustees and officers with respect thereto) as well as non-operating expenses such as brokerage commissions and fees and expenses associated with the Fund’s securities lending program, if applicable, will not exceed the annual rate set forth in Schedule A of the average daily net assets of the class (computed in the manner set forth in the Trust’s Trust Instrument) throughout the month. For avoidance of doubt, it is understood that this agreement shall not apply to any other class other than Class Z6 of the Fund.

  • Accounting Provisions Unless otherwise expressly provided herein, all references in this Agreement to GAAP shall mean GAAP as in effect on the date of this Agreement as published by the Financial Accounting Standards Board. All accounting terms used in this Agreement and not defined expressly, completely or specifically herein shall have the respective meanings given to them, and shall be construed, in accordance with GAAP. All financial data (including financial ratios and other financial calculations) required to be submitted pursuant to this Agreement shall be prepared in accordance with GAAP applied in a manner consistent with that used to prepare the most recent audited consolidated financial statements of the Borrower and its Subsidiaries. All financial or accounting calculations or determinations required pursuant to this Agreement shall be made, and all references to the financial statements of the Borrower, Adjusted EBITDA, Senior Secured Debt, Total Debt, Interest Expense, Consolidated Total Assets and other such financial terms shall be deemed to refer to such items, unless otherwise expressly provided herein, on a consolidated basis for the Borrower and its Subsidiaries. Notwithstanding the foregoing, leases shall continue to be classified and accounted for on a basis consistent with that reflected in the financial statements of the Borrower for the fiscal year ended December 31, 2018 for all purposes, notwithstanding any change in GAAP relating thereto, including with respect to Accounting Standards Codification 842.

  • Interpretive and Additional Provisions In connection with the operation of this Agreement, the Custodian and each Fund on behalf of each of the Portfolios, may from time to time agree on such provisions interpretive of or in addition to the provisions of this Agreement as may in their joint opinion be consistent with the general tenor of this Agreement. Any such interpretive or additional provisions shall be in a writing signed by all parties and shall be annexed hereto, provided that no such interpretive or additional provisions shall contravene any applicable federal or state regulations or any provision of a Fund’s Governing Documents. No interpretive or additional provisions made as provided in the preceding sentence shall be deemed to be an amendment of this Agreement.

  • Effective Period, Termination and Amendment; Interpretive and Additional Provisions This Custodian Agreement shall become effective as of the date hereof, shall continue in full force and effect until terminated as hereinafter provided, and may be amended at any time by mutual agreement of the parties hereto. This Custodian Agreement may be terminated by either party by written notice to the other party, such termination to take effect no sooner than sixty (60) days after the date of such notice. Notwithstanding the foregoing, if Ally Financial resigns as Servicer under the Basic Documents or if all of the rights and obligations of the Servicer have been terminated under the Servicing Agreement, this Custodian Agreement may be terminated by the Issuing Entity or by any Persons to whom the Issuing Entity has assigned its rights hereunder. As soon as practicable after the termination of this Custodian Agreement, the Custodian shall deliver the Receivable Files described herein to the Issuing Entity or the Issuing Entity’s agent at such place or places as the Issuing Entity may reasonably designate.

  • Common Areas - Definition The term "Common Areas" is defined as all areas and facilities outside the Premises and within the exterior boundary line of the Industrial Center that are provided and designated by the Lessor from time to time for the general non-exclusive use of Lessor, Lessee and of other lessees of the Industrial Center and their respective employees, suppliers, shippers, customers and invitees, including parking areas, loading and unloading areas, trash areas, roadways, sidewalks, walkways, parkways, driveways and landscaped areas.

  • Definition of Proprietary Information The Executive acknowledges that he may be furnished or may otherwise receive or have access to confidential information which relates to the Company’s past, present or future business activities, strategies, services or products, research and development; financial analysis and data; improvements, inventions, processes, techniques, designs or other technical data; profit margins and other financial information; fee arrangements; compilations for marketing or development; confidential personnel and payroll information; or other information regarding administrative, management, or financial activities of the Company, or of a third party which provided proprietary information to the Company on a confidential basis. All such information, including in any electronic form, and including any materials or documents containing such information, shall be considered by the Company and the Executive as proprietary and confidential (the “Proprietary Information”).
